2023 JSS-G7 Term 3 Integrated Science MidTerm Exam
This document contains a mid-term exam for Integrated Science consisting of 14 multiple choice and short answer questions. It provides instructions to candidates to answer all questions in the spaces provided. The questions cover topics like identifying laboratory apparatus, measuring instruments, properties of mixtures, sources of electricity, and health of the kidneys. Scoring guidelines are also included, breaking performance into four levels from exceeding expectations to below expectations.
